Overview

CVE-2016-10528 is a medium-severity vulnerability affecting restafary_project restafary. It was published on May 31, 2018 and has a CVSS 3.0 base score of 4.9 (MEDIUM).

This vulnerability has a CVSS 3.0 base score of 4.9, rated MEDIUM. It can be exploited remotely over the network. Some level of privileges is required for exploitation.

Technical Description

restafary is a REpresentful State Transfer API for Creating, Reading, Using, Deleting files on a server from the web. Restafary before 1.6.1 is able to set up a root path, which should only allow it to run inside of that root path it specified.

Affected Products

Vendor Product Versions Status
restafary_project restafary >= 0, < 1.6.1 Affected
